What Is a bid Bond and Why Is It Crucial?
a bid bond functions as an economic safeguard in the building bidding procedure. It ensures that you'll honor your bid if awarded the project.
Basically, it shields the job proprietor from potential losses if you back out after winning the agreement. By providing a bid bond, you show your dedication and integrity, which can enhance your online reputation among customers.
It likewise aids you stand apart from competitors that might not use this assurance. Without a bid bond, you run the risk of losing opportunities, as numerous projects require it as part of the bidding process.
Recognizing the importance of bid bonds can assist you secure agreements and build trust with clients while guaranteeing you're monetarily protected throughout the bidding process.
Exactly How bid Bonds Job: The Refine Explained
When you make a decision to place a bid on a building task, understanding how bid bonds work is important for your success.
First, you'll require to acquire a bid bond from a surety business, which functions as an assurance that you'll satisfy your obligations if granted the contract. bonded 'll typically pay a premium based upon the complete bid quantity.
Once you submit your bid, the bond ensures the job proprietor that if you fail to honor your bid, the surety will certainly cover the costs, as much as the bond's restriction.
If you win the contract, the bid bond is typically changed by a performance bond. This procedure aids shield the interests of all events entailed and makes certain that you're serious about your proposition.
